#2ab894 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2ab894 is composed of 16.5% red, 72.2%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 19.6%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 164.8 degrees, a saturation of 62.8% and a lightness of 44.3%. #2ab894 color hex could be obtained by blending #54ffff with #007129.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

Shades and Tints of #2ab894

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020807 is the darkest color, while #f7fdfc is the lightest one.
